Sure, that warm, fuzzy feeling only goes so far, and at the end of the day, what matters in a service is how well it performs. Customer service on a local level can bring tangible benefits to the table in terms of IT performance. Having a local team to support customers, field calls when issues on the network and jump in to help solve challenges when they arise means faster resolution — keeping your network more reliable. A network provider that knows your region or town has a personal understanding of what powerful internet and connectivity means to your business and community and builds accordingly. Choosing a smaller provider as opposed to a large incumbent means more agility where you need it and a more consultative approach that helps organizations get the exact solutions they need. Gone are the one-size-fits-all solutions that don’t truly meet unique needs or goals.
In short? The home field advantage that comes from local, trusted providers is that business is made personal. That’s what will set good IT apart from truly outstanding, transformational solutions.
